¡Ah, la frustración! Te sientas frente a tu ordenador, ansioso por iniciar tu jornada o continuar con tus proyectos, y de repente… tu sistema Ubuntu con su moderno entorno gráfico 3D (a menudo GNOME Shell, KDE Plasma, o algún otro que aprovecha las capacidades 3D de tu tarjeta gráfica) decide que no te reconocerá. Intentas tu contraseña una y otra vez, pero la pantalla de inicio de sesión te devuelve al mismo punto, implacable. Es una situación desalentadora, un verdadero „bloqueo de sesión”, pero no te preocupes. Estás en el lugar correcto. Esta guía exhaustiva te acompañará paso a paso para desentrañar el misterio y devolverte el control de tu sistema. Prepárate, porque vamos a sumergirnos en el corazón de Ubuntu.
La imposibilidad de ingresar a tu cuenta de usuario es una de las incidencias más comunes y a la vez más desconcertantes para cualquier usuario, ya sea novato o experimentado. Pero la buena noticia es que, en la mayoría de los casos, la solución está al alcance de la mano, aunque a veces requiera un poco de ingenio y la valentía de adentrarse en la terminal.
🤔 ¿Por Qué No Puedo Acceder? Un Vistazo a las Causas Comunes
Antes de saltar a las soluciones, es fundamental comprender las posibles razones detrás de este bloqueo de sesión. Conocer la causa puede acelerar drásticamente el proceso de recuperación. Aquí te presento las más frecuentes:
- Contraseña Incorrecta: La causa más obvia y, a veces, la más pasada por alto. Un error tipográfico, el Bloq Mayús activado o un cambio de teclado puede ser el culpable.
- Problemas con el Entorno Gráfico (Xorg/Wayland, Drivers): Los controladores gráficos defectuosos, una configuración de pantalla corrupta o un problema con el servidor X (o Wayland) pueden impedir que la interfaz gráfica se cargue correctamente.
- Espacio en Disco Insuficiente: Si tu partición raíz (
/
) está llena, el sistema no puede crear archivos temporales o de sesión, lo que impide el ingreso. Esto es sorprendentemente común. - Archivos de Configuración de Usuario Corruptos: Los archivos de configuración de tu entorno de escritorio, ubicados en tu directorio personal (
~/.config
,~/.local
), pueden dañarse y evitar que tu sesión se inicie. - Permisos de Archivos Incorrectos: Si los permisos de tu directorio personal o de archivos críticos se han alterado, el sistema podría negarse a iniciar tu sesión.
- Fallos en el Gestor de Arranque (Display Manager): LightDM (predeterminado en Ubuntu hasta hace poco), GDM3 (predeterminado en Ubuntu con GNOME) o SDDM pueden corromperse y no presentar la interfaz de inicio de sesión o no procesar tu entrada correctamente.
- Actualizaciones de Sistema Fallidas: Una actualización interrumpida o con errores puede dejar el sistema en un estado inconsistente, afectando componentes críticos para el inicio de sesión.
🚨 Primeros Auxilios: Comprobaciones Rápidas y Básicas
No subestimes el poder de lo simple. Antes de aventurarnos en el intrincado mundo de la línea de comandos, hagamos algunas comprobaciones básicas que a menudo resuelven el problema en un instante:
- ¿Bloq Mayús Activo? (Caps Lock): 💡 Parece obvio, ¿verdad? Pero es el culpable de innumerables frustraciones. Asegúrate de que no esté encendido.
- Distribución del Teclado: ⌨️ ¿Has cambiado recientemente la distribución de tu teclado? A veces, la pantalla de inicio de sesión usa una distribución diferente a la que esperas (por ejemplo, inglés en lugar de español), lo que cambia la posición de caracteres especiales en tu contraseña.
- Reiniciar el Sistema: 🔄 Un reinicio simple puede resolver problemas temporales de software o servicios que se han quedado atascados. No es una solución a largo plazo si el problema es persistente, pero es un buen primer paso.
- Probar con Otro Usuario: 👥 Si tienes otro usuario configurado en el sistema, intenta iniciar sesión con esa cuenta. Si funciona, el problema probablemente radica en la configuración de tu usuario principal, no en el sistema base.
🛠️ Soluciones Avanzadas: Recuperando el Control desde la Consola
Si las comprobaciones básicas no dieron resultado, es hora de arremangarse y usar las herramientas que Ubuntu pone a nuestra disposición. Para esto, necesitaremos acceder a la consola de texto, ya sea a través de un TTY (Terminal Teletype) o mediante el modo de recuperación de GRUB.
Paso 1: Accediendo a la Consola TTY
Cuando te encuentres en la pantalla de inicio de sesión fallida, puedes presionar Ctrl + Alt + F1
(o F2, F3, F4, F5, F6) para cambiar a una consola de texto pura. Esto te dará un prompt para ingresar tu nombre de usuario y contraseña.
Ubuntu 22.04 LTS jammy tty1 jammy login:
Introduce tu nombre de usuario y luego tu contraseña. Si logras iniciar sesión aquí, significa que tu sistema base está funcionando, y el problema es específicamente con tu entorno gráfico o gestor de sesiones. Una vez dentro, eres root y puedes ejecutar comandos administrativos.
1.1. 💾 Revisar el Espacio en Disco
¡Este es un sospechoso frecuente! Si la partición raíz (/
) está llena, tu sesión no podrá iniciarse. Ejecuta:
df -h
Busca la línea correspondiente a /
y verifica el porcentaje de uso. Si está al 100% o muy cerca, ¡bingo! Necesitas liberar espacio. Algunos comandos útiles:
- Limpiar cachés de paquetes APT:
sudo apt clean sudo apt autoremove
- Eliminar archivos temporales o registros grandes (¡con precaución!):
sudo rm -rf /tmp/* sudo journalctl --vacuum-time=7d
- Identificar archivos grandes en tu directorio personal (¡si tienes acceso SSH o sabes dónde buscar!):
du -sh /home/tu_usuario/* | sort -rh
Esto te mostrará los directorios y archivos más grandes en tu directorio personal, ordenados de mayor a menor. Puedes empezar a borrar descargas antiguas, vídeos grandes, etc.
1.2. 🔄 Reiniciar el Gestor de Sesiones (Display Manager)
Si el problema es con LightDM, GDM3 u otro gestor, reiniciarlo puede ser suficiente. Identifica cuál usas (GDM3 para GNOME, LightDM para Unity/Mate/XFCE, etc.) y ejecuta:
sudo systemctl restart lightdm # O gdm3, sddm, etc.
Después de ejecutar esto, presiona Ctrl + Alt + F7
(o F1, F2, etc., prueba hasta encontrar la pantalla gráfica de inicio de sesión) para volver a la interfaz gráfica e intentar iniciar sesión nuevamente.
Paso 2: Accediendo al Modo de Recuperación (GRUB)
Si ni siquiera puedes iniciar sesión en un TTY, es probable que el problema sea más profundo. El Modo de Recuperación de GRUB es tu siguiente mejor opción. Para acceder a él:
- Reinicia tu ordenador.
- Justo después de que el logotipo del fabricante desaparezca (o si tienes un arranque dual, cuando GRUB aparece), mantén presionada la tecla
Shift
(o presionaEsc
repetidamente siShift
no funciona) para mostrar el menú de GRUB. - Selecciona la entrada de Ubuntu (generalmente la primera) y luego presiona
E
para editar los parámetros de arranque. - Busca la línea que comienza con
linux
. Al final de esa línea, reemplazaquiet splash
conrecovery nomodeset
o simplementesingle
(para un shell de root). - Presiona
Ctrl + X
oF10
para arrancar con estos parámetros. - Deberías llegar a un menú de recuperación o directamente a un shell de root. Si llegas al menú de recuperación, selecciona la opción „root – drop to root shell prompt”.
Una vez en el shell de root, tu sistema de archivos estará montado en modo de solo lectura por seguridad. Para poder hacer cambios, necesitas montarlo en modo de lectura/escritura:
mount -o remount,rw /
2.1. 🔑 Resetear la Contraseña
Si la contraseña es el problema, esta es la solución definitiva. En el shell de root, ejecuta:
passwd tu_nombre_de_usuario
Se te pedirá que introduzcas una nueva contraseña dos veces. ¡Asegúrate de recordarla esta vez! Después de cambiarla, escribe exit
para salir del shell y selecciona „Resume normal boot” o reinicia el sistema con reboot
.
2.2. 📂 Chequear y Reparar el Sistema de Archivos
Un sistema de archivos corrupto puede causar todo tipo de problemas. Desde el modo de recuperación, puedes ejecutar fsck
para verificar y reparar errores:
fsck -f /dev/sda1 # Reemplaza /dev/sda1 con la partición raíz de tu Ubuntu.
# Si no sabes cuál es, consulta 'cat /etc/fstab' desde un TTY o Live USB.
Asegúrate de que la partición no esté montada cuando ejecutes fsck
. Si estás en modo de recuperación, debería estar bien. Si te pregunta si reparar errores, responde y
.
2.3. 💽 Liberar Espacio en Disco (Repetición desde TTY, pero vital aquí)
Lo hemos mencionado antes, pero es tan crucial que merece la pena repetirlo. Si estás en el modo de recuperación y sospechas que la falta de espacio es el problema, los mismos comandos de limpieza de APT y búsqueda de archivos grandes se aplican. Asegúrate de haber montado el sistema de archivos en modo de lectura/escritura primero.
2.4. 🖥️ Reinstalar o Reconfigurar el Display Manager
Si tu gestor de sesiones está dañado, reinstalarlo puede solucionar el problema. Desde el shell de root o un TTY:
sudo apt update
sudo apt install --reinstall lightdm # O gdm3, sddm
sudo dpkg-reconfigure lightdm # O gdm3, sddm
El comando dpkg-reconfigure
te permitirá seleccionar el gestor de sesiones predeterminado si tienes varios instalados. Después, reinicia.
2.5. 🎮 Resolver Problemas de Controladores Gráficos (Drivers)
Los drivers son una fuente común de dolores de cabeza en el entorno 3D. Si sospechas que son los culpables (por ejemplo, después de una actualización de kernel o de drivers propietarios de NVIDIA/AMD), puedes intentar:
- Desinstalar drivers propietarios conflictivos:
sudo apt purge nvidia-* # O amdgpu-pro si usas AMD
Luego, reinicia. Esto debería hacer que el sistema vuelva a usar los drivers de código abierto (Nouveau para NVIDIA, o los integrados para Intel/AMD) que suelen ser más estables para el inicio.
- Borrar archivos de configuración de Xorg: A veces, un
xorg.conf
mal configurado puede causar el problema. Puedes eliminarlo o renombrarlo (para tener una copia de seguridad):sudo mv /etc/X11/xorg.conf /etc/X11/xorg.conf.backup
Xorg intentará generar uno nuevo automáticamente al siguiente arranque.
2.6. ⚙️ Archivos de Configuración de Usuario Corruptos
Los archivos de configuración de tu sesión de usuario pueden ser la raíz del problema. Si has probado otro usuario y funciona, esta es una pista importante. Los archivos clave suelen estar en tu directorio personal y comienzan con un punto (son ocultos). Para probar si son la causa, puedes renombrar los directorios de configuración de tu usuario:
cd /home/tu_usuario
mv .config .config_backup
mv .local .local_backup
mv .gnome2 .gnome2_backup # Si usas GNOME antiguo
mv .gconf .gconf_backup
mv .cache .cache_backup
Al reiniciar y volver a iniciar sesión, el sistema recreará estos directorios con configuraciones por defecto. Si logras entrar, sabrás que el problema estaba ahí. La desventaja es que perderás toda tu personalización. Luego, puedes empezar a restaurar archivos específicos de .config_backup
hasta que encuentres el que causa el conflicto.
💡 Una de las herramientas más potentes en la recuperación de Ubuntu es la capacidad de usar un Live USB. Si todas las opciones anteriores fallan o te sientes inseguro modificando el sistema directamente, arrancar desde un USB en vivo te permite acceder a tus archivos, realizar copias de seguridad cruciales y, desde ahí, incluso montar tu sistema y ejecutar comandos como si estuvieras en un TTY.
2.7. 🔐 Permisos de Archivos Incorrectos
Si los permisos de tu directorio personal se han corrompido, Ubuntu no te permitirá iniciar sesión. Puedes corregirlos con estos comandos (desde un TTY o modo recuperación):
sudo chown -R tu_nombre_de_usuario:tu_nombre_de_usuario /home/tu_nombre_de_usuario
sudo chmod -R u+rwX /home/tu_nombre_de_usuario
El primer comando asegura que el usuario y grupo sean los propietarios de todos los archivos y directorios en tu directorio personal. El segundo establece permisos de lectura, escritura y ejecución para el propietario.
2.8. ⬆️ Problemas de Actualización
Si el problema surgió después de una actualización, es posible que el proceso no se completara correctamente. Desde un TTY o modo de recuperación:
sudo apt update
sudo apt upgrade
sudo dpkg --configure -a
sudo apt install -f
Estos comandos intentarán actualizar los paquetes, configurar cualquier paquete pendiente y resolver dependencias rotas.
Cuando Todo Falla: Un Plan de Contingencia
Si has probado todas estas soluciones y sigues sin poder acceder, es el momento de considerar opciones más drásticas. Pero no te desanimes, ¡aún hay esperanza para tus datos!
- Copia de Seguridad de Datos: Este es el paso más crucial. Desde el modo de recuperación, o mejor aún, arrancando con un Live USB de Ubuntu, puedes acceder a tu disco duro y copiar tus archivos importantes (documentos, fotos, etc.) a un disco externo.
- Reinstalación del Sistema: Una vez que tus datos estén seguros, una reinstalación limpia de Ubuntu es a menudo la solución más rápida y sencilla para un sistema muy comprometido. Durante la instalación, puedes optar por mantener tus archivos personales si los tienes en una partición separada (
/home
) o sobrescribir todo si ya hiciste una copia de seguridad.
Mi Opinión Personal: La Resiliencia de Linux y la Comunidad
He pasado por la frustración de un sistema que no me permite ingresar, y sé lo que se siente. Es como si tu propio ordenador te cerrara la puerta en la cara. Sin embargo, mi experiencia de años utilizando y diagnosticando problemas en Ubuntu y otras distribuciones Linux me ha enseñado una valiosa lección: la resiliencia de estos sistemas es asombrosa. A diferencia de otros sistemas operativos donde un problema de arranque puede significar una reinstalación automática y la pérdida de datos, en el mundo Linux, casi siempre hay una forma de acceder al corazón del sistema, diagnosticar la avería y repararla. Los datos lo respaldan: la estructura abierta y modular de Linux permite una depuración y reparación granular que a menudo no es posible en sistemas cerrados.
Además, la inmensa comunidad de usuarios de Ubuntu es un recurso invaluable. Desde foros especializados hasta wikis y documentaciones, siempre encontrarás a alguien que ha experimentado un problema similar y ha compartido la solución. Estas experiencias, aunque inicialmente desafiantes, son oportunidades fantásticas para aprender más sobre cómo funciona tu sistema operativo, empoderándote y haciéndote un usuario más competente.
Conclusión: No Te Rindas
Ser „bloqueado fuera de tu sesión” en Ubuntu es, sin duda, una experiencia desagradable. Pero con paciencia, la ayuda de la consola y esta guía, la mayoría de los usuarios pueden resolver estos problemas sin tener que recurrir a medidas drásticas. Recuerda, cada problema es una oportunidad para aprender algo nuevo y fortalecer tu conocimiento del sistema operativo. ¡Espero que esta guía te haya ayudado a recuperar el control total de tu experiencia Ubuntu!